#544180 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#544180 is composed of 32.9% red, 25.5% green and 50.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 34.4% cyan, 49.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 258.1 degrees, a saturation of 32.6% and a lightness of 37.8%. #544180 color hex could be obtained by blending #a882ff with #000001.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

● #544180 color description : Dark moderate violet.
#544180 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#544180 has RGB values of R:84, G:65, B:128 and CMYK values of C:0.34, M:0.49, Y:0, K:0.5. Its decimal value is 5521792.

Shades and Tints of #544180
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#07060b is the darkest color, while #fdfd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#544180
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#605f62 is the less saturated color, while #3c06bb is the most saturated one.
